ANNOUNCE: nfs-utils-2.5.1 released.

Hello,

There is a new command as added 'nfsdclnts' that
shows client info on the Linux server. 

clddb-tool was renamed to nfsdclddb

A number of memory leaks were plugged up.

Add support for SASL binds

As well as a number of bug fixes.
